I liked this appreciably more than Leviathan Wakes. In Caliban’s War, the pace slows from the frenetic bombard of it predecessor. There is time for past-due character development as well as the introduction of some likable new players. Holden is less irritating and we get to know Amos and Alex better. 

Although this is a somewhat pessimistic vision of the future, I really enjoy the inclusion of heroes as opposed to the evermore prevalent antiheroes.
